One full cycle at normal current lets the coulomb counter re-map against the new cell before fast-charge currents are applied.\u003c\/li\u003e\n  \u003c\/ul\u003e\n\n  \u003chr class=\"bpw-desc-divider\"\u003e\n\n  \u003ch3 class=\"bpw-desc-h3\"\u003eWhy the N988Z reports wrong battery percentage after a cell swap\u003c\/h3\u003e\n  \u003cp class=\"bpw-desc-p\"\u003eThe N988Z uses a coulomb counter that learns the charge curve of whichever cell is installed. When you swap in a new cell, the counter still holds the old cell's data. The percentage readout can show 80% while the actual state of charge is significantly lower. One complete discharge down to the device's auto-shutoff point, followed by a full charge, flushes the old data and writes a new curve to the fuel gauge IC.\u003c\/p\u003e\n\n  \u003ch3 class=\"bpw-desc-h3\"\u003eSudden shutdown at 20–30% on the replacement cell\u003c\/h3\u003e\n  \u003cp class=\"bpw-desc-p\"\u003eLi-Polymer cells have a voltage cliff near the bottom of their discharge curve — around 3.4V under load. The N988Z's modem and display pull current spikes that the fuel gauge does not fully anticipate when the cell curve is uncalibrated. The phone reads 25% remaining but the cell voltage drops below the BMS cutoff threshold the moment load increases. After the first full recalibration cycle, the fuel gauge maps this voltage cliff correctly and shuts down closer to the true 0% mark.\u003c\/p\u003e\n\u003c\/div\u003e","brand":"BatteryWeb","offers":[{"title":"Warranty 1 Year","offer_id":43392097124442,"sku":"BWCS-ZTN988SL-1","price":26.99,"currency_code":"USD","in_stock":true},{"title":"Warranty 2 Year","offer_id":43392097157210,"sku":"BWCS-ZTN988SL-2","price":29.99,"currency_code":"USD","in_stock":true},{"title":"Warranty 3 Year","offer_id":43392097189978,"sku":"BWCS-ZTN988SL-3","price":32.99,"currency_code":"USD","in_stock":true}],"thumbnail_url":"\/\/cdn.shopify.com\/s\/files\/1\/0674\/4775\/0746\/files\/BW-CS-ZTN988SL-1.webp?v=1779143764","url":"https:\/\/batteryweb.com\/products\/zte-n988z-replacement-battery-38v-3000mah-li-polymer","provider":"BatteryWeb","version":"1.0","type":"link"}
